So, some facts. Firstly, Find The Way Out runs in deadeningly logical chronological order, starting with a handful of very hard-to-find tracks from their “missing” (presumed disowned) first album, the noisy, aimless, sub-Dinosaur Jr. Ichabod & I , before working through their other albums in order. These are, in case you don’t know, the raggedy FX-pedal indie of Everything’s Alright Forever ; the quantum-leap into eclectic genius of Giant Steps ; the hit-housing obtuse Britpop of Wake Up! ; the gloriously energetic artrock of C’Mon Kids ; and finally the lacklustre but appealing farewell of Kingsize . In case you didn’t notice, that’s two outstanding albums, two very good albums, one OK album and one album that no one’s heard because you can’t get it anywhere and even the band think it’s pretty poor.
